Game one of the Stanley Cup Final is finally upon us! Although it’s only been six days since the Oilers clinched the Western Conference, it feels more like it’s been 83 years (yes this is a Titanic reference). But the most anticipated final in years gets underway tonight.
Canada’s team, the Florida Panthers, will host the Edmonton Oilers in game one. The Panthers opened as a -120 favourite to win the series on Sunday night, but have now made their way to becoming sizeable -150 favourites as it seems like a lot of the public’s money is going on the Panthers.
A matchup I can’t wait to see is hockey’s best offensive player in Connor McDavid matched up against hockey’s best defensive forward in Selke winner Alexander Barkov, with two of hockey’s best goal scorers as their running mates. McDavid of course has 50 goal scorer Zach Hyman, and Barkov has 50 goal scorer Sam Reinhart.
Today’s expected goaltender matchups for our highlighted game:
The Florida Panthers’ Sergei Bobrovsky (36-17-4) vs. The Edmonton Oilers’ Stuart Skinner (36-15-2).
